Abstract

Official abstract text for this publication.

Provided is a one-piece injection molded part which is used to assemble an optical module, the one-piece injection molded part including: a plurality of plates and a plurality of living hinges. The plurality of plates includes an input faceplate, an output faceplate, a left side plate, a right side plate, a bottom plate and a lid plate and is integrally formed.

What is claimed: 1. A one-piece injection molded part which is used to assemble an optical module, the one-piece injection molded part comprising: a plurality of plates comprising: an input faceplate comprising at least one input slot configured to allow entry of an input component; an output faceplate comprising at least one output slot configured to allow entry of an output component; a left side plate; a right side plate; a bottom plate; and a lid plate; and a plurality of living hinges, wherein the plurality of plates is integrally formed; and wherein the lid plate comprises a first locking feature configured to engage with a second locking feature provided on an interior surface of the input faceplate to keep the lid portion in a closed position. 2. The one-piece injection molded part of claim 1 , wherein the input faceplate, the output faceplate and the left and right side plates are bent from the bottom plate at locations of the plurality of living hinges. 3. The one-piece injection molded part of claim 1 further comprising a plurality of wall holding members which keep the plurality of plates in an assembled position. 4. A method of forming an optical module from a one-piece injection molded part comprising a plurality of plates, a plurality of living hinges, an input plate of the plurality of plates comprising at least one input slot configured to allow entry of an input component, an output plate of the plurality of plates comprising at least one output slot configured to allow entry of an output component, and a lid plate of the plurality of plates comprising a first locking feature which engages with a second locking feature provided on the input faceplate of the plurality of plates to keep the lid portion in a closed position, the method comprising: bending the plurality of plates at locations of the plurality of living hinges, wherein the plurality of plates is integrally formed; and engaging the first locking feature and the second locking feature thereby keeping the lid portion in a closed position. 5. The method of claim 4 , wherein the plurality of plates comprises: a left side plate; a right side plate; and a bottom plate; wherein the input faceplate, the output faceplate and the left and right side plates are bent from the bottom plate at locations of the plurality of living hinges.
